Pagini recente » Monitorul de evaluare | Borderou de evaluare (job #1913957) | Borderou de evaluare (job #2341496) | Borderou de evaluare (job #1432510) | Cod sursa (job #938367)
Cod sursa(job #938367)
var p, n, i, x, k:longint;
begin
clrscr;
assign(input,'fact.in');
assign(output,'fact.out');
reset(input);
rewrite(output);
readln(p);
i:=0;
if p<0 then writeln('-1')
else if p=0 then writeln('1')
else begin
repeat
inc(i);
until (p*4+i) mod 5=0;
writeln(p*4+i);
end;
close(input);
close(output);
end.